Contents
1 - Data Protection
1.1 - Data Acquisition, Storage, Access, Processing and Control
1.2 - Personal and Sensitive Data
1.3 - Data Rectification and Deletion
1.4 - Codes of Conduct and Certification
1.5 - Data Protection Officer
2 - Data Protection Regulations
2.1 - General Data Protection Regulation
2.2 - European Union Data Protection Regulation
3 - Privacy and Data Protection in Artificial Intelligence and Data Science Systems
4 - Information and Communication Technologies and Security Threats
5 - Types of Cybercrime
5.1 ? Malware
5.2 ? Phishing
5.3 ? Identity Theft
5.4 ? Cyberterrorism
5.5 ? Cybercrime Techniques
6 ? Cybercrime Prevention and Protection
7 ? Cybersecurity in Artificial Intelligence Systems
8 ? Artificial Intelligence applied to Cybersecurity
9 ? Artificial Intelligence Security
Learning Outcomes
CO1 - Master the main aspects to consider in Privacy and Security
CO2 - Understand how Privacy and Security should be considered and applied to Intelligent Systems
CO3 - Know and master the methods and techniques of Artificial Intelligence that can be applied to Privacy and Security
CO4 - Have a critical sense about the types of attacks on Artificial Intelligence and the methods and techniques to prevent, detect and mitigate them
